New Hampshire SB547 seeks to enhance regulation and transparency of pharmacy benefit manager practices. The bill mandates that pharmacy benefit managers submit quarterly reports to the commissioner, detailing rebates collected and other financial information. It also establishes a fiduciary duty for pharmacy benefit managers to health carrier clients, prohibiting them from retaining any portion of spread pricing. The commissioner is required to publish an annual transparency report on the insurance department’s website, promoting transparency and competitive markets.
